01 September 2016
Tehran - First Vice-President Es'haq Jahangiri said that more than half of Iran's population is under social security cover.

According to the report of Vice-President Office, Jahangiri in meeting with Secretary General of International Social Security Association (ISSA) Hans-Horst Konkolewsky here on Wednesday said that Iran's Social Security Organization needs international interactions and expressed hope that by presence of Mr. secretary general of ISSA in Iran, the organization can use international experiences and opportunities.

He underlined that Iran's retirement funds need reforms and expressed hope that in negotiations between secretary general of ISSA and head of Iran Social Security Organization international experiences could be used for implementing the reforms.

Jahangiri also expressed hope that by holding regional seminar of ISSA in Tehran, its outcomes could play effective role in exchanging experiences and progresses of social security goals in member-states, including Iran.

Konkolewsky praised Iran Social Security Organization's activities, and said that he believes the body has done positive works in different dimensions and other member- states are eager to use Iranian experiences in this concern.

He said that he is going to present a report for admirable activities and measures of Iranian Social Security Organization to General Assembly meeting of ISSA in Panama, as well as to ISSA headquarter in Geneva.

Konkolewsky said that countries are using different patterns in their social security bodies, one is upon participation model and another one is upon receiving taxes, but the Iranian model is admirable and could be used as successful model in other countries.

He stressed that the ISSA is fully committed to present help and support for Iranian organization, and expressed readiness for reforming retirement funds.
